What does a director optical network engineer do?

A Director Optical Network Engineer oversees the design, implementation, and maintenance of optical networking systems within an organization. They lead a team of engineers, develop strategies for network optimization, and ensure that high-speed data transmission requirements are met using technologies like DWDM and SONET. Their role also involves managing large-scale network projects, working with vendors, and ensuring network reliability and scalability to support the organization's business go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a director optical network engineer?

To thrive as a Director Optical Network Engineer, you need deep expertise in optical networking technologies, network architecture, and a relevant engineering degree, often supported by significant leadership experience. Familiarity with industry-standard tools like DWDM, SONET/SDH, ROADM, and network management systems, as well as certifications such as Cisco or Juniper, is highly valuable. Exceptional leadership, strategic thinking, and communication skills help drive teams and projects toward successful implementation. These skills are crucial for managing complex network infrastructures and ensuring high-performance, scalable, and reliable optical networks.

How does a director optical network engineer typically coll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ure network performance and reliability?

A Director Optical Network Engineer regularly works with cross-functional teams, including operations, product management, and customer support, to design, implement, and maintain high-performance optical networks. They lead technical discussions, translate business requirements into network solutions, and ensure that network upgrades or changes align with organizational goals. Effective collaboration is crucial, as it helps to quickly resolve issues, optimize network capacity, and drive innovation while maintaining service reliability. Strong communication and leadership skills are essential for facilitating these collaborative efforts.

Company Description
CTC Technology & Energy (CTC) is an established, 30-year old, growing independent communications and IT engineering consulting firm. We work at the highest levels on cutting-edge communications networking projects for public sector and non-profit clients throughout the U.S. Current projects include long-term fiber optic and wireless regional communications interoperability initiatives in the Washington, DC area, funded by the U.S. Department of Homeland Security, design and implementation of wireless networks, engineering design and business modeling and project oversight for broadband networks, and advising the federal government.
CTC is a vibrant, fun, exciting workplace with some of the most complex networking projects in the country. These include metropolitan area fiber networks, nationwide fiber access architectures, developing national broadband policies, planning the implementation of the FirstNet public safety wireless broadband network, and deploying new generations of wireless technologies.
